The hardest part of driving and learning how to drive is mastering how to park without scratching or denting your new car. Town Driver allow you to drive around the parking lot simulating new life skills required for a car safety in the correct spot. Will you be able to park all the cars without leaving a scratch?
Mountain Climb: Stunt Racing Game
Aliens Bubble Shooter
Paint Run 3D
Chic Wedding Salon
Jeep Ride
Mahjong Mania!
Fast Food Match 3
Water Crysis
Dead Zombie Hunting
Helix Jump Halloween
Mandala Coloring Book
Water Slide Car Race
Urban Derby Stunt And Drift
Flat Jewels Match 3
Geometry Fresh
Sea Treasure Match 3
HidJigs Spring
Dragon City Destroyer
Knife Smash
Princess Family Halloween Costume
Chippolino
Drive Boat
Fill Ball
Monster Attack
Extreme Impossible Tracks Stunt Car Racing 3D
Arcade Drift
Color Snake
Live Aqua Hero Adventure
Rope Help
Express Truck